MIAMI -- Pat Riley and Giannis Antetokounmpo would love for LeBron James to return to South Beach.
Riley said he has been in touch James' agent, Rich Paul, but that the Heat are like everybody else and waiting to see what the game's biggest free agent decides to do.
"I don't know, I'll be honest with you," Riley told ESPN about whether a James-Heat reunion will happen. "Obviously, we've had conversations with Rich and they were very good. So if that happens and he wants to come to the '305,' we got a golf course. The weather's nice. Steve Kerr, same thing down here. And there's no state tax. So that's a little better than California."
